[Wi-Fi] Replace WifiTracker with WifiTracker2 for SavedAccessPointsWifiSettings2

Use SavedNetworkTracker instead of WifiTracker, it provides Wi-Fi signal information
for saved networks. This is the main UX difference of this change.
